Police discovered an injured man after being called to reports of screaming coming from woodland in Garston at the weekend.

Hertfordshire Constabulary attended Alban Wood the near Woodgate at 9.17pm on Friday after receiving calls from alarmed residents who heard a disturbance from the area.

Officers soon found an 18-year-old with head wounds and launched a search of the area including door-to-door enquiries.

The teenager was later taken to Watford General Hospital for treatment.

The police investigation was ended after the young man told officers he had fallen and no evidence was found of violence being involved in the incident.
